You need to whip the front bumper off mate. With the cooler there should have been brackets to mount the rad (as removing the original cooler you lose the top and bottom mounts for that side) and to relocate the fan more to the left of the rad as you look from the front. Then it should just be a case of popping it onto the hoses doing up the clips and putting the front bumper back on

bumper has either 4 bolts/2screws or 2 bolts/2screws

scerws are located either side of the bumper at the wheelarch. usually rusted, drill the heads off

bolts are on the front pannel 1 or 2 on either side. you just need to remove the nuts as the bolts are captive on the bumpers, bit of a squeeze but easiest is usually with the front jacked up slightly or might be able to get at them from the engine bay squirt liberally qwith WD half hour before doing it, will make life easier.

you can get the inner 2 nuts from inside the engine bay! the 1 outer nut can be a nightmare cos the washer bottle is in the way on the passenger side,the other side is easy.also a screw in each side of bumper to the wheel arch.
